The hon. Lady will know that the Government are seeking to balance the moneys that the Government need to renew public services while ensuring that businesses are treated fairly. I will raise her concerns directly with Treasury Ministers and get her an update on what further action the Government intend to take. We want community businesses and facilities to be retained wherever possible.
